What Makes Bedding Ideal for Summer Sleep?
Bedding ideal for summer sleep should be lightweight, breathable, and moisture-wicking to ensure comfort during hot temperatures.
- Lightweight Materials
- Breathable Fabrics
- Moisture-Wicking Properties
- Appropriate Fill Weight
- Color Choices
- Cooling Technologies
Understanding these attributes can significantly enhance summer sleeping experiences.
-
Lightweight Materials: Bedding described as lightweight consists of fabrics that do not weigh down the sleeper. Common lightweight materials include cotton, linen, and bamboo. These fabrics allow for improved airflow, making them ideal for warm nights. A study by the Sleep Research Society (2020) indicated that lighter bedding resulted in less tossing and turning in warmer months.
-
Breathable Fabrics: Bedding characterized by breathable fabrics helps circulate air and prevent heat buildup. Cotton remains one of the most popular choices due to its natural fibers that promote ventilation. Similarly, linen, made from flax, is known for its breathability and ability to absorb moisture. According to a report by the Textile Research Journal (2021), breathable bedding reduced body temperature by an average of 2°C during sleep.
-
Moisture-Wicking Properties: Bedding with moisture-wicking properties quickly draws sweat away from the body, aiding in temperature regulation. Fabrics like Tencel and some synthetic blends are designed to manage humidity and dryness effectively. Research by the Journal of Applied Physiology (2019) demonstrated that moisture-wicking materials can improve sleep quality, particularly in hot and humid climates.
-
Appropriate Fill Weight: The fill weight of blankets and comforters refers to their thermal insulation. Lightweight fills, such as microfiber or down alternatives, provide comfort without overheating. The maximum comfortable fill weight for summer bedding typically ranges between 200-400 grams per square meter. According to a 2020 study by the National Sleep Foundation, lighter fills resulted in improved sleep comfort during summer months.
-
Color Choices: The color of bedding can impact how cool or warm it feels. Light-colored fabrics reflect sunlight and heat, helping to keep a sleeping environment cooler. Bright whites and pastel blues or greens are often preferred in summer settings. A color study by the Environmental Psychology Journal (2018) found that light colors contributed to perceived comfort and satisfaction in bedroom environments.
-
Cooling Technologies: Some summer bedding incorporates cooling technologies, such as phase-change materials (PCMs) designed to absorb and release heat. These innovative fabrics can adapt to body temperature fluctuations, offering personalized comfort. A 2021 research paper by the Journal of Consumer Research highlighted that bedding with cooling technologies significantly enhances sleep quality, particularly in warm conditions.
How Do Cooling Properties Affect Sleep Comfort?
Cooling properties significantly enhance sleep comfort by helping regulate body temperature, reducing sweat, and creating a more conducive sleep environment. These factors contribute to improved sleep quality and duration.
-
Body temperature regulation: The human body’s ideal sleeping temperature is around 60 to 67 degrees Fahrenheit (15 to 19 degrees Celsius). Maintaining a cooler environment aids in falling asleep faster. A study by Okamoto-Mizuno and Mizuno (2012) indicates that lower environmental temperatures promote better sleep efficiency and quality.
-
Reduction of sweat: Effective cooling properties in bedding materials reduce moisture retention. Materials like breathable cotton or cooling gel mattresses wick away sweat. According to research by Tzeng and Shiu (2015), this moisture management helps maintain a comfortable sleeping surface, preventing disturbances due to discomfort from perspiration.
-
Enhanced sleep environment: Cooling elements in pillows and mattresses contribute to a more comfortable microclimate around the sleeper. This environment allows for deeper sleep stages, such as REM (Rapid Eye Movement) sleep, which is crucial for cognitive health. According to Walker (2017), better sleep efficiency from a cooling environment leads to improved memory consolidation.
-
Prevention of overheating: When the body overheats, it can disrupt sleep cycles. Cooling technologies like phase-change materials (PCMs) absorb and release heat to maintain a steady temperature. Research by Wang et al. (2020) found that bedding with PCM can significantly reduce nighttime awakenings associated with heat discomfort.
-
Psychological comfort: A cooler sleeping environment can also provide a psychological sense of comfort and relaxation. The association between a serene sleeping space and reduced stress enhances overall sleep quality. A systematic review in the Journal of Clinical Sleep Medicine highlighted the influence of environmental comfort on sleep satisfaction (Hirshkowitz et al., 2015).
The combination of these factors demonstrates that cooling properties in bedding and sleep environments plays a crucial role in optimizing both the quality and comfort of sleep.
Which Materials Are Most Effective for Summer Bedding?
The most effective materials for summer bedding are breathable and moisture-wicking fabrics that help regulate body temperature.
- Cotton
- Linen
- Bamboo
- Microfiber
- Tencel
The choice of bedding material can significantly impact sleep quality during the hot summer months. Each material has unique properties that can cater to different preferences.
-
Cotton:
Cotton is a natural fiber known for its breathability and softness. Cotton sheets provide good airflow, preventing overheating. According to a study by the Cotton Incorporated Lifestyle Monitor™ Survey, 91% of respondents preferred cotton for summer bedding due to its comfort. Cotton also absorbs moisture well, making it ideal for warm nights. -
Linen:
Linen, made from flax fibers, is highly breathable and has excellent moisture-wicking properties. Linen bedding keeps the body cool as it allows heat to escape. Research by the Journal of Textiles indicates that linen can absorb up to 20% of its weight in moisture before feeling damp. This quality helps with sweat management during hot weather, although some may find it more textured compared to cotton. -
Bamboo:
Bamboo fabric is produced from the pulp of the bamboo plant and is known for its softness and moisture-wicking abilities. Bamboo sheets can regulate temperature and have natural antibacterial properties. A study in the Journal of Forest Products revealed that bamboo fabric is more breathable than traditional cotton. However, availability can sometimes be an issue, as bamboo bedding may be more expensive than cotton options. -
Microfiber:
Microfiber is a synthetic material made from polyester and polyamide. It is lightweight and can wick moisture away from the body. Microfiber bedding can dry quickly after washing. While it may not be as breathable as natural fibers, it is inexpensive and can be suitable for those with allergies, as it repels dust mites. -
Tencel:
Tencel, or lyocell, is made from sustainably sourced wood pulp. It is breathable, moisture-wicking, and biodegradable. Studies show that Tencel sheets regulate temperature better than cotton and contribute to a comfortable sleep environment. Its silky feel appeals to many, but it typically comes at a higher price point than cotton and microfiber.
How Do Natural Fibers Enhance Breathability in Warm Weather?
Natural fibers enhance breathability in warm weather by allowing air circulation, wicking moisture, and providing thermal regulation. These properties significantly improve comfort during hot climates.
Air circulation: Natural fibers such as cotton and linen have a porous structure. This structure allows air to flow freely through the fabric. According to a study by Zhang et al. (2019), fabrics made from cotton can increase air permeability, which helps keep the body cool. Improved air circulation reduces the risk of overheating.
Moisture wicking: Natural fibers effectively absorb and release moisture. For example, cotton can absorb up to 27 times its weight in water. When sweat evaporates from the fabric surface, it creates a cooling effect. Lee et al. (2020) found that fabrics with high moisture-wicking capabilities help maintain skin dryness in humid conditions. This property is vital for comfort in warm weather.
Thermal regulation: Natural fibers possess excellent thermal properties. They can quickly adapt to temperature changes, maintaining a comfortable body temperature. Wool, for instance, has a unique ability to retain heat in cold conditions while remaining breathable in warmer weather. According to a study by Bains et al. (2021), breathable fabrics prevent heat buildup by allowing heat to escape. This feature is crucial during hot months.
Eco-friendliness: Natural fibers are biodegradable and sustainable. This creates less environmental impact compared to synthetic fibers. Research by Fard et al. (2020) highlights that using natural materials promotes sustainability without sacrificing breathability.
These characteristics of natural fibers make them ideal for warm weather clothing, ensuring comfort and promoting a better experience in high temperatures.
Can Synthetic Fabrics Provide Benefits for Hot Nights?
Yes, synthetic fabrics can provide benefits for hot nights. These materials often have moisture-wicking properties.
Synthetic fabrics, such as polyester and nylon, are designed to draw moisture away from the skin. This feature helps keep the body dry and cool, especially in hot and humid conditions. Additionally, many synthetic textiles are lightweight and breathable, which allows for better air circulation around the body. Some synthetic materials also offer UV protection, enhancing comfort during warm weather. Their durability often makes them a practical choice for summer sleepwear or bedding.
What Types of Bedding Should You Choose for the Summer?
Choosing the right bedding for summer is essential for comfort and a good night’s sleep. Lightweight materials that promote breathability and moisture-wicking qualities are ideal during warmer months.
- Cotton
- Linen
- Bamboo
- Micromodal
- Silk
- Polyester blends
- Cooling gel-infused bedding
To understand the advantages and characteristics of each bedding type, let’s explore their individual attributes.
-
Cotton: Cotton bedding is highly popular due to its softness and breathability. It allows air to circulate, which helps regulate temperature. Cotton also absorbs moisture well, keeping you dry at night.
-
Linen: Linen bedding is crafted from flax fibers. It has a loose weave that promotes airflow and has natural moisture-wicking properties. Linen’s texture increases comfort during hot weather, and it becomes softer with each wash.
-
Bamboo: Bamboo sheets are known for their eco-friendliness and moisture-wicking abilities. The fabric is breathable and hypoallergenic, making it a comfortable choice for those with sensitive skin. Bamboo also has natural antibacterial properties.
-
Micromodal: Micromodal is a type of rayon made from beech tree fibers. It is extremely soft and breathable. Unlike traditional fabrics, micromodal does not cling to the body, making it an excellent summer option.
-
Silk: Silk bedding provides a luxurious feel and is naturally temperature-regulating. It helps keep you cool in summer and warm in winter. However, it may require more care and maintenance than other materials.
-
Polyester blends: Polyester blends often combine comfort and durability. While not as breathable as natural materials, many polyester blends are designed to wick moisture away, making them suitable for summer use.
-
Cooling gel-infused bedding: Cooling gel-infused bedding is engineered to regulate body temperature. This technology helps dissipate heat, providing a refreshing sleeping experience. It is especially beneficial for those who tend to overheat at night.
Why Are Lightweight Duvets Particularly Suitable for Hot Weather?
Lightweight duvets are particularly suitable for hot weather for several reasons:
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Breathability | They are typically made from lightweight materials that allow for better air circulation, helping to regulate body temperature. |
| Moisture-wicking | Many lightweight duvets have moisture-wicking properties, which help to draw sweat away from the body, keeping the sleeper cool and dry. |
| Reduced Heat Retention | Compared to heavier duvets, lightweight options provide less insulation, preventing overheating during warm nights. |
| Easy to Manage | They are easier to handle and can be easily removed or adjusted, making them convenient for changing temperatures throughout the night. |
| Weight | Lightweight duvets are generally lighter in weight compared to traditional duvets, making them more comfortable for warm weather. |
| Versatility | They can be used alone or layered with other bedding for more flexibility in temperature control. |
